nounDefinition of REWARD
1
: something that is given in return for good or evil done or received or that is offered or given for some service or attainment <the police offered a reward for his capture>
2
: a stimulus administered to an organism following a correct or desired response that increases the probability of occurrence of the response
Examples of REWARD
- The contest offered a cash reward to the first person who could breed a blue rose.
- Hard work brings its own rewards.
- Members will receive a discount in reward for getting friends or family to join.
First Known Use of REWARD
14th century
